HISTORY : Henry G. Long was born in the city of Lancaster, Pennsylvania on August 23, 1804. He attended local schools and received his legal training from G. B. Porter. In 1827 he was admitted as a member of the Lancaster bar and shortly afterwards was appointed as assistant prothonotary of the district. He was elected solicitor for the commission of the county sometime in the 1830's and held that position for twenty consecutive years. In 1836 he was elected a member of the convention to amend the Constitution of the State. Long was elected to the state legislature in 1838 remaining in office until he was elected President Judge of the Court of Common Pleas of Lancaster County in 1851. He held that position until he retired in 1871.
CONTENTS: The account ledger of Lancaster, Pennsylvania attorney and county judge Henry G. Long from May 3, 1836 to April 30, 1842. Includes a daily account of legal services rendered and the amount received.
